MOROCCO


Rocco, he's a bird
Living in a big cage
He makes himself heard
When he's in a rage

Fighting with the mirror
Moving back and forth the beads
It is quite clear
As he squawks to plead

His case there in his world
Where he has no mate
Maybe he needs a girl
Perhaps he wants a date

With another female budgie
Pretty lady friend
Not so handsome and a little pudgy
So he won't have to pretend

That the bird in the mirror will talk back
Another budgie who's like him but real
Would he cared for a her or attack
Wish he'd tell me how he'd feel.
